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
73790727442 0212843 55018997 854
6144032819 831796231 9405406
6144032819 831796231 9405406
83986027 50865315 4492
All about undefined
Interested in learning more?
6144032819 831796231 9405406
83986027 50865315 4492
See more
848433 06155129
3771094325 017124476 191473548 61355
See more
29272705 3313 748670
88299903 296 389
See more